### Capacity note: clock skew across Forgeline build agents

We've measured growing clock skew between the Ketterby and Ashvale agent pools, which is corrupting cache-key timestamps and inflating rebuild rates by roughly eight percent. Before we buy more agents, we should tighten NTP sync intervals and reject artifacts whose timestamps drift past tolerance, since most of the apparent capacity shortfall is wasted rebuilds. Proposed tolerances and sync settings follow.

tuning constants:
QUOTAS = {
    "druwyn": 5,
    "holix": 5,
    "zorath": 5,
    "holwyn": 10,
}

This page documents the service account used by the Grainhaul fleet fuel-usage report. The nightly job, owned by the Odometry team, pulls refueling events from the Tanklog service and aggregates liters-per-route into the weekly dashboard. The account has read-only scope and rotates quarterly; maintainers should update the scheduler secret when rotation occurs. The current key for the Tanklog internal API appears below.

service key, fawip-bajef: kto11_Qt5wZK9vdNC

Handover note — payslips for the Tarnbrook site

As you know, Tarnbrook still has no working printer, so payroll has printed this month's payslips here and sealed them in a single envelope pouch. Driver should take them out on tomorrow's morning run alongside the regular consumables box. The confidential hand-over instruction for the courier is below.

dispatch memo: the quenax olidor courier leaves the lamvan aldath keliel ledger at gate 2085 under passcode 005795

## Break-Glass: FormulaCage Sandbox

Support: user-supplied formulas in Quanta Sheets run inside FormulaCage. If the sandbox wedges and customer calcs stall, escalate to Tier 2 first. If no Tier 2 within 15 minutes, use break-glass to restart the evaluator pool yourself.

Steps: open the Cage console, select the stuck shard, hit Force Drain. Log the incident in Tracker before and after. Misuse is audited weekly by the Helix team.

The console prompts for the recovery passphrase shown below.

vault phrase of fahog-yajof = istael-zorwyn